    slab on grade or Mat?

    Raft foundations are designed to carry relatively heavy load transmitted by columns or walls of structures on weak soils. Slab on grade can be described as mass or reinforced concrete slab on a prepared subgrade which carries relatively lighter loads which interact directly with it (for example...
